Synopsis

More than 400,000 people complete a marathon in the United States each year. This book is about twelve of those runners. Why they run. What running has done for them-and to them. Their triumphs and their failures. My Running Club is not a "how to run a marathon" book. It is fiction, but it reveals the truth behind marathon training programs and the people who set the pace of their lives on the running trail. Alan Anderson has completed sixteen marathons, one ultra-marathon, and numerous half marathons, 10k races, and 5k races. He has coached marathon and half-marathon runners for a dozen years. He lives in Houston with his wife Betsy, who is also a long-distance runner.
